How To Keep the Area Around Your Bathroom Sink Drying Rack Clean and Dry

Maintaining a clean and dry bathroom is essential for a healthy and pleasant environment. One common area that can become cluttered and prone to moisture buildup is the space around the bathroom sink drying rack. This area often harbors damp towels, toothbrushes, and other items that can contribute to mold growth and unpleasant odors. This article will explore practical strategies to keep the area around your bathroom sink drying rack clean and dry, ensuring a hygienic and aesthetically pleasing bathroom.

Choose the Right Drying Rack

The first step towards a clean and dry bathroom sink area is selecting the appropriate drying rack. A well-designed drying rack can significantly contribute to a clean and organized environment. Consider the following factors when choosing a drying rack:

  • Material: Stainless steel or chrome racks are durable, easy to clean, and resist rust. Metal racks, however, can be susceptible to watermarks and may require regular polishing. Plastic racks are lightweight and affordable but are not as durable and may be prone to warping or cracking over time.
  • Size and Shape: Opt for a drying rack that fits comfortably within the available space and accommodates your towel and bathing needs. Consider a rack with multiple tiers or adjustable shelves to maximize storage space.
  • Design: Choose a rack with a design that allows for good air circulation, promoting drying and preventing moisture buildup. Look for racks with open spaces or strategically positioned bars to prevent water from pooling.

A well-chosen drying rack will provide a designated space for damp items, preventing clutter and encouraging quick drying.

Implement Effective Drying Practices

Once you have a suitable drying rack, it's crucial to implement efficient drying practices to minimize moisture and prevent mold growth. Consider the following:

  • Thorough Drying: Before placing towels or other items on the drying rack, ensure they are thoroughly wrung out to remove excess water. This step significantly reduces drying time and minimizes the potential for prolonged dampness.
  • Air Circulation: Position the drying rack in a well-ventilated area that allows for optimal air circulation. Avoid placing it near closed walls or cabinets, as this can trap moisture and impede drying. Open a window or use a fan for increased ventilation, especially after showering or bathing.
  • Regular Cleaning: Regularly clean the drying rack and the surrounding area to remove any accumulated dirt, debris, or mold. Use a mild cleaning solution and a soft cloth to wipe down the rack. Pay close attention to the areas where water pools or drips.

By implementing these practices, you can ensure that your drying rack effectively dries items and minimizes the risk of moisture-related problems.

Maintain a Clean and Dry Environment

Maintaining a clean and dry environment around the bathroom sink drying rack is crucial for preventing mold growth, mildew buildup, and unpleasant odors. Consider these additional tips:

  • Clean Spills Immediately: Regularly clean any spilled water or toothpaste around the sink area. This prevents moisture buildup and minimizes the potential for mold growth.
  • Use a Bathroom Mat: Place a bath mat in front of the sink to absorb dripping water and prevent the floor from becoming wet. Choose a mat made of absorbent materials like microfiber or cotton, and ensure it is regularly laundered.
  • Ventilation: Ensure good ventilation in the bathroom, even when not in use. This could involve leaving the door slightly ajar or using an exhaust fan to remove moisture from the air.

By consistently maintaining a clean and dry environment around the bathroom sink drying rack, you can create a hygienic and aesthetically pleasing bathroom space.
